Transaction 5e627593ff3e9e38efe222683ecaa896d88b79f6f55dd5b27ae3447e5eca09fa

1 Input
2 Outputs
  • 5e627593ff3e9e38efe222683ecaa896d88b79f6f55dd5b27ae3447e5eca09fa:0
  • value  435374184
    address  3HVMjBAAh6MQr8EQn12x4QoPg8sqEcHyqo
  • 5e627593ff3e9e38efe222683ecaa896d88b79f6f55dd5b27ae3447e5eca09fa:1
  • value  293000000
    address  18SshWr2PwZqoeDDdUnZT6Z9fvBjjhdjtc